Role Summary
Develop and own IP-level verification for Qualcomm wireless IP blocks (WAN, WLAN, GNSS, Bluetooth). Work on design analysis, verification planning, testbench and test development, simulation and coverage closure, and debug of RTL/testbench issues.
Collaborate with design, architecture, and cross-functional teams to maintain scalable, reusable verification environments and drive delivery of high-quality IP.
Experience Level
Senior (role listing spans Engineer β Sr Engineer β Sr Lead). The posting indicates 1β6 years of relevant hardware/verification experience depending on degree level.
Responsibilities
Key responsibilities include ownership of verification activities and improving verification methodology and efficiency.
- Plan and execute IP-level verification: analysis, verification plans, and coverage goals.
- Develop SystemVerilog/UVM testbenches and write test cases and assertions.
- Create constraint-random tests and drive coverage closure through simulation.
- Debug RTL and testbench issues using industry tools and workflows.
- Explore and apply advanced DV methodologies (formal, static, simulation) to improve quality and efficiency.
- Maintain and scale verification environments for reuse across projects.
- Collaborate with design, architecture, and cross-functional teams to meet milestones.
Requirements
Must-have technical skills and practical experience for this role.
- Must-have: Strong SystemVerilog and UVM experience; proven ability to build and maintain medium-to-complex SV/UVM environments.
- Must-have: Experience with coverage-driven verification and writing efficient constraint-random tests.
- Must-have: Strong debug skills using tools such as Verdi or equivalents.
- Must-have: Scripting for automation (Python or Perl).
- Nice-to-have: Exposure to wireless IPs (WiβFi, modem PHY, DSP blocks).
- Nice-to-have: Familiarity with formal/static verification techniques.
- Nice-to-have: Power-aware verification and gate-level simulation (GLS) experience.
Education Requirements
Bachelor's, Master's, or PhD in Computer Science, Electrical/Electronics Engineering, or a related engineering field. The posting allows degree alternatives with equivalent experience: typical minimums listed are Bachelor's +3 years, Master's +2 years, or PhD +1 year of relevant hardware/verification experience.
